Cherry Mobile outs three new budget Android tablets

Cherry Mobile continues its trend of offering budget-friendly Android tablets with the release of three new slates with price tags just under Php5K.

Let’s start with the most expensive of the bunch, the Cherry Mobile Superion Explorer. It’s a 7-inch tablet that has full call and SMS capabilities. It is powered by a Snapdragon 8225 dual-core CPU clocked at 1GHz, Android Jellybean, and 3,000mAh battery.

Next is the Cherry Mobile Fusion Storm, a 7.85-inch slate that is powered a 1.2Ghz dual-core CPU, 512MB RAM, Android Jellybean and 3,000mAh battery.

The last one, the Cherry Mobile Fusion Breeze, is the cheapest at under Php2K. It has a 7-inch display, 512MB RAM, Android Jellybean and powered by a 1.2GHz single-core CPU.

All tablets will be available in Cherry Mobile concept stores, concept kiosks and accredited dealers nationwide starting next week.
